Project Overview

The wooden toothpick manufacturing project involves the production of high-quality wooden toothpicks from sustainable sources of hardwood, such as bamboo or birch. This industry leverages the abundant supply of wood materials, focusing on creating an essential hygiene product used widely in restaurants, food service establishments, and households. With the increasing consumer awareness about hygiene and health, the demand for wooden toothpicks is on the rise. The manufacturing process typically encompasses sourcing raw materials, cutting, shaping, packaging, and distribution. By adopting efficient machinery and skilled labor, manufacturers can streamline operations, reduce waste, and optimize production costs. Additionally, there is potential for diversification in product offerings, including flavored toothpicks and eco-friendly packaging solutions. The business can cater to both domestic markets and export demands, given the growing trend for sustainable wooden products. As an environmentally friendly alternative to plastic picks, wooden toothpicks align with global sustainability efforts, making them an attractive product for eco-conscious consumers.

SWOT Analysis

Strengths

  • Sustainable sourcing of raw materials.
  • Low production costs compared to plastic alternatives.
  • Strong market demand for eco-friendly products.

Weaknesses

  • Susceptibility to price fluctuations in raw materials.
  • High competition from plastic toothpick manufacturers.
  • Limited product differentiation in a saturated market.

Opportunities

  • Expansion into flavored and creatively designed toothpicks.
  • Partnerships with restaurants for bulk supply contracts.
  • Increased market penetration through online sales channels.

Threats

  • Regulatory changes affecting wood sourcing.
  • Potential economic downturn leading to reduced consumer spending.
  • Emergence of alternative products like biodegradable plastics.
